| Abstract [eng] |
Although peer-review has proved to be beneficial in many writing classrooms abroad, this method is scarcely used among Lithuanian educators. Different studies highlight contrastive results, weighing either to the benefit of teacher-or peer-review. The value of peer-review is often underestimated because teachers tend to undervalue students’ abilities as both writers and reviewers. To achieve the most from peer-review, it is important to define the actual expectations for peer-review and to form an appropriate peer-editing rubric as a helpful tool for peer-reviewers. Different analyses of peer-reviewed and self-reviewed writings highlighted the differences between peer-reviewers’ and self-reviewers’ ability to notice errors, revise, and improve writings. [...]. |
